Top 5 Online Shopping Websites For Clothes

Many consumers are reluctant to buy clothes online, despite the fact that a good shopping experience online is crucial for buyers. The inability to feel the fabric and the fear of shipping charges are the main reasons for them to avoid online shopping.

There are plenty of websites online that offer trendy and cheap clothes to fit every style and budget. Many of them offer sizes that are inclusive which makes them excellent options for women of all shapes and sizes.

The Outnet

The Outnet is a shopping mall online that sells designer clothing at discounts, sometimes up to 70 70%. The Outnet is part of the YOOX Net-a-Porter Group is a popular destination for bargain-hunters and luxury shoppers. The company's dedication to authenticity and high-end fashion has made it an industry leader in the e-commerce space. The site offers exclusive collections and collaborative efforts.

The Outnet offers designer clothing at bargain prices as well as accessories, shoes, and bags. The extensive collection of the company includes brands that specialize in menswear, womenswear, and bridal. The Outnet offers a range of sustainable options for fashion, including resale, repair and resale services. It also works with organizations that work to minimize the impact the fashion industry has on the environment.

The Outnet offers several payment options that include PayPal, Klarna, and credit and debit cards. The Outnet allows customers to return their purchases in the event that they are not suitable. Customers can choose to receive their refund either in store credit or return it to the original payment method. Additionally, The Outnet offers free express shipping on orders that exceed $300. The Outnet provides customer support in multiple languages to answer any questions you may have. TopCashback is an online community that lets shoppers to earn cashback on The Outnet.

Shopbop

Shopbop is an online retailer that sells thousands of renowned and emerging fashion brands. The site has well-curated collections that match the modern style of a modern woman. They also launch new products every day. The site also offers compelling editorial content and styling tips. Additionally, Shopbop offers world-class customer service and free global shipping on all purchases.

On the website, customers will find everything they need from dresses to shoes and accessories. They also have a dedicated application for iOS and Android devices. The apps let users browse the latest offerings and purchase items traveling. The company also holds several sales throughout the year. Prime members also receive a number exclusive benefits, such as free two-day shipping and discounted next-day delivery.

Additionally, the company has revamped its product pages with images that are 60% larger and a new Facebook tab that provides articles on fashion trends. It also has launched a daily fashion update from the company's newly appointed fashion director Treena Lombardo. This content is intended to give shoppers an idea of how the products will look on them. This will help them decide if they are in the right size and prevent purchasing something that isn't right for them.

Farfetch

Farfetch is a marketplace that connects brands, boutiques and consumers. It provides a carefully selected selection from established brands, boutiques, and designers of designer clothing, bags, shoes, and accessories. It also features items by emerging designers and boutiques, which are otherwise difficult to find. Its global network allows it to offer a variety of sizes and styles.

Farfetch offers free returns and an easy-to-use interface, making it easy to shop. The site also allows users to add items to their wish lists and to add items to their shopping cart. Customers can also sign up for an account, which gives access to a personal area and rewards program.

In addition to its vast range of products, Farfetch has a dedicated group of customer service representatives who are available to answer any questions and assist you with your purchase. The company is a publicly traded company, and its reputation has been supported by a generous return policy as well as high quality standards.

Farfetch unlike other high-end online shopping websites, does not control the inventory displayed on its site. Instead, it acts as a middleman, connecting buyers with thousands of boutiques around the world. Farfetch is able to search its network for similar items when a product is sold in the boutique. Urban Outfitters

Urban Outfitters is an American fashion brand that is a specialist in on-trend clothes and accessories for young adults. Founded in 1970, the company has over 200 stores across the United States and other countries. The parent company of the company, URBN owns retail brands Anthropologie and Free People. The company employs aesthetics, social networks, and influencers as marketing tools.

The company offers men's and women's clothes, shoes, accessories, home goods, beauty and online Shopping websites For clothes wellness products, as well as homewares. The stores are designed to be aesthetically pleasing and immersive, attracting fashion-forward and creative young adults. The company's revenue streams comprise sales from retail stores, e-commerce and exclusive private label brands.

The ethics of the company even in the face of their popular image, are questionable. In its response to California's Transparency in Supply Chains Act the company described itself as "dedicated to enthralling customers with an unbeatable combination of innovation, product, and cultural understanding". The company has not provided any evidence to show that it is taking measures to ensure that its vendors don't employ children or slave labour.

The Frankie Shop

The Frankie Shop has become a sought-after contemporary fashion brand known for its minimalistic design and timeless style. The curated collection of high-end basic pieces and versatile styles appeal to fashion enthusiasts who seek understated sophistication. The growing popularity of the brand is due to its attention to quality, and its ability to incorporate contemporary elements into classic styles.

A strict sourcing policy guarantees that the brand's collection is made from high-quality materials and is in line with the company's strict sustainability standards. In addition, the company collaborates with a network of skilled artisans to bring its designs to life. This helps the brand maintain a consistent level of quality and a focus on timeless style.

Celebrities and influencers have played an important part in the growth of the company. Its clothing has been seen on a variety of influential influencers and celebrities, bolstering its popularity and extending its reach to a new audience.

The Frankie Shop is inspired by its Parisian roots and has produced a collection of essentials for your wardrobe that are stylish and practical. Shoppers can find oversized bea jackets and blazers in neutral colors, as well as padded muscle tees and pleated trousers. The collection of the company also includes a selection of accessories and bags that are designed to match its distinctive style.
